Heavy metal icon Metallica returned to Denver’s Empower Field at Mile High on Friday, June 27, in Denver, as part of its M72 World Tour.
The act also has a Sunday, June 29, concert planned for Empower — Colorado’s largest concert venue, and one that in the past has hosted shows by Taylor Swift, The Rolling Stones, U2 and others.
Hard-rock acts Limp Bizkit and Ice Nine Kills opened the June 27 concert, while Pantera and Suicidal Tendencies are scheduled to open the July 29 show.
